Japan offers to buy 119,718 tonnes food wheat via tender

Japan's Ministry of Agriculture is seeking to buy 119,718 tonnes of food quality wheat from the United States and Canada in a regular tender that will close late on Thursday.

Japan, the world's sixth-biggest wheat importer, keeps a tight grip on imports of the country's second most important staple after rice and buys the majority of the grain for milling via tenders typically issued three times a month.
